Preview: Arickaree/Woodlin vs. Genoa-Hugo

Genoa-Hugo may have come out ahead in their last contest, but they shouldn't get too cocky given who is up next. Arickaree/Woodlin and Genoa-Hugo go head to head on Friday at 7:00 PM in their first playoff contest of the year. Genoa-Hugo know how to get points on the board -- the team has finished with flashy point totals in its past six matchups -- so hopefully Arickaree/Woodlin like a good challenge.

After having lost a blowout in their game two weeks ago against Idalia, Genoa-Hugo were happy to find some success last week. It was just another Friday night under the lights for Genoa-Hugo, who beat Eads 51-41. Genoa-Hugo found their leader in underclassman freshman Colby Simmons, who rushed for 122 yards and 2 touchdowns on 11 carries. That makes it four straight good games in a row from Simmons.

In almost any game, 48 points would all but guarantee a win. Not in this one. Arickaree/Woodlin steamrollered North Park 84-48. For those curious, yes, that was the biggest win Arickaree/Woodlin have assembled all season.

Their wins bumped Arickaree/Woodlin to 6-2 and Genoa-Hugo to 5-3. We'll see who bends and who breaks when these two typically dominant teams face off.
